For heavy carbon deposits inside the combustion chamber, a top cleaning product may be added to the engine to soak for 15-20 minutes to loosen the deposits. An oil change afterward is recommended because some of the cleaner will end up in the crankcase.

An engine flush is basically the process of a technician placing chemicals in the engine oil to break down sludge or carbon deposits from old oil.
This process often involves injecting a decarbonizing solution into the engine's intake system while running. The solution dissolves the carbon deposits, which are expelled through the exhaust system. This method is highly effective and ensures that all engine parts are adequately cleaned.

The carbon build up is almost the same for every gasoline, high or low octane number. Octane itself will have nothing to do with carbon build up. But premium grades of gas may have a better detergent package, that may reduce carbon build up.

The carbon build-up is the reason for the misfire (rough running engine). This signals the check or service engine light to come on, letting the driver know there is an issue with their engine's performance. This is a typical problem which plagues these engines when the mileage hits 30-60,000.

Removing Carbon Buildup
Place the piston at the top dead center so that the valves are closed. Then, scrape carbon gently from the cylinder head, using a wooden or plastic scraper. Take care not to dig the scraper into the aluminum.
